Output 29ea7ae3ae05e1a06f3bf3b46ace509c58f78107af66e83af7e72f0ce9100bc8:1

value
65837609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aadfc68da63db2bbb7702a40bd66ccbaa5bae90 OP_EQUAL
address
3ELHbmqPF2XmLKZQUGkTtMy89Roneqpbk8
transaction
29ea7ae3ae05e1a06f3bf3b46ace509c58f78107af66e83af7e72f0ce9100bc8
spent
true